What Is Stained Concrete?

Local Stained ConcreteStained Concrete
Stained concrete is an ornamental treatment related to concrete surfaces that enhances their aesthetic appeal. This process entails the application of a fluid discolor that passes through the surface area, producing a lively and abundant shade. There are 2 key kinds of spots: acid-based and water-based. Acid-based spots respond chemically with the concrete, creating a transparent finish, while water-based spots offer a broader shade palette and are less complicated to collaborate with.

Discoloration can be related to various surfaces, consisting of floors, driveways, and patio areas, making it a functional choice for both indoor and outdoor rooms. The therapy can attain a variety of appearances, from earthy tones to vibrant, modern-day styles. Unlike paint, stained concrete preserves its look with time, as it becomes an important component of the concrete itself. In general, stained concrete works as an effective method for transforming common concrete right into aesthetically striking surface areas.

Acid Staining Approach

Exactly how can property owners change plain concrete surface areas right into aesthetically striking attributes? One effective approach is acid staining, a popular technique that boosts the all-natural appeal of concrete. This procedure involves applying a solution of water, hydrochloric acid, and metallic salts to the concrete surface. As the acid reacts with the lime present in the concrete, it creates rich, variegated shades that look like marble or stone. Acid discoloration is understood for its longevity and resistance to fading, making it a resilient selection for both indoor and outdoor applications. Nonetheless, it is necessary to note that the outcomes can vary based on the initial concrete shade and texture - Austin Stained Concrete Floors. Proper application and sealing are important for attaining the preferred visual and durability

Water-Based Discoloration Technique

A prominent option to acid staining, the water-based staining method uses homeowners a flexible method to boost concrete surfaces. This method uses water-soluble dyes and pigments, enabling a wide variety of colors and surfaces. Unlike acid stains, water-based stains can be applied to unsealed concrete and offer a simpler clean-up procedure. The outcomes can attain a much more consistent appearance and can be layered to develop unique results. Additionally, water-based discolorations are typically less toxic and produce fewer unpredictable natural substances (VOCs), making them a lot more eco-friendly. House owners may value the capacity to personalize their concrete surface areas with various tones, enabling innovative expression while preserving resilience and longevity in their floor covering options.

Maintenance and Treatment for Stained Concrete


Correct upkeep ensures the longevity and charm of stained concrete surfaces. Normal cleaning is essential; making use of a light detergent and water with a soft-bristle brush assists get rid of dust and crud without harming the surface. It is recommended to stay clear of harsh chemicals that can strip away the stain or sealer.

Sealing stained concrete is important for security versus dampness, spots, and wear. A high-grade sealant must be reapplied every one to 3 years, relying on the website traffic and direct exposure the surface area endures. In addition, resolving spills promptly will prevent staining and staining.

Cost Considerations for Stained Concrete Projects

When planning a discolored concrete task, spending plan factors to consider play a necessary role in establishing the overall price. The expenses connected with stained concrete can differ significantly based on a number of elements. The dimension of the location to be stained directly affects material and labor prices. Larger rooms will normally require more resources. Second, the kind of discolor chosen-- acid-based or water-based-- can influence rates, with acid stains usually being extra expensive. In addition, the intricacy of the layout, consisting of patterns or multiple colors, can boost labor prices. Preparation work, such as cleaning and grinding the concrete surface, contributes to the first costs too. The choice in between DIY setup and employing a professional specialist will better impact the budget. Comprehending these variables allows property owners to make educated financial decisions about their stained concrete jobs, guaranteeing they achieve the wanted visual within their economic ways.
